Abstract

The utility model discloses a kind of Portable pull body-building devices, comprising: handle, resistance gauge and antiskid pedal, handle are connected by pulling force rope with resistance gauge, and resistance gauge is connected by connecting rope with antiskid pedal, and antiskid pedal bottom end is provided with the buckle of fixed handle;Resistance gauge includes shell, two web-type flywheels and central axis, and two web-type flywheels are symmetrically fixedly installed in the both ends of central axis, and shell covers on the outside of two web-type flywheels, and central axis both ends are fixed on the shell by bearing, and pulling force rope sling is around on central axis.The utility model is not only simple in structure, easy to carry, and pulling force size can be adjusted according to self-demand.

Working principle of the utility model is:
In use, expansion antiskid pedal 3, handle 1 is taken out from buckle 6, then with it is foot-operated live antiskid pedal 3, with outer Power rotary middle spindle 23 rolls up pulling force rope 4 on central axis 23 in the counterclockwise direction, and both hands hold handle 1, pulls at drawing outward Power rope 4 is rotated clockwise at this point, pulling force rope 4 will drive web-type flywheel 22;Then, the arm of user inwardly moves, Under the effect of inertia of disc type flywheel, pulling force rope 4 is rotated clockwise on rollback to central axis 23 again, at this point, both hands again to Pulling force rope 4 is pulled at outside, pulling force rope 4 will drive web-type flywheel 22 again and be rotated counterclockwise, and so on operates, just form The reciprocal outer motion exercise expanded.When outer drawing pulling force rope 4, web-type flywheel 22 is rotated.According to the size of pulling force, web-type flywheel 22 The speed of rotation is also different, and the size of inertia force is also different, and the rotation of web-type flywheel 22 is faster, and inertia force is bigger.When pulling force rope 4 is drawn When out, because the reason of inertia will be continued to rotate along the former direction of motion, pulling force rope 4 is withdrawn and is twined web-type flywheel 22 by movement while It is wound on central axis 23, human hand, which firmly holds pulling force rope 4, makes web-type flywheel 22 slow down.When web-type flywheel 22 is because of human hand pulling force It stops operating or reaches capacity after position stops operating, human hand again firmly pulls out pulling force rope 4, keeps web-type flywheel 22 reversed Movement.Thus under the action of human hand pulling force, 22 inertia force of web-type flywheel, can continuous repetitive operation, reach body-building Purpose.In addition, shell 21 is opened, in the mounting groove 25 that clump weight 26 is snapped onto 22 outer end face of web-type flywheel, regulates and match After weight, shell 21 is closed and is fixed.In this way by adjusting installation site and quantity, the quality of clump weight 26, also just have adjusted The size of 22 rotating inertia force of web-type flywheel, 22 torque of web-type flywheel is bigger, and inertia force is bigger.It can be according to different target users' Demand voluntarily adjusts the torque of web-type flywheel 22.
After use, pedal 2 33 is folded to the back side of pedal 1, then resistance gauge 2 and handle 4 are placed in and are stepped on The back side of plate 1, and be fastened in buckle 6, occupied space is reduced, the portability of chest expander is improved.
